Healthy Moms, Healthy Kids

Did you know that children of fit mothers are 75% less likely to develop obesity? It’s a startling statistic that the researchers at Harvard University’s T.H. Chan School of Public Health recently found when they gathered data from monitoring almost 25,000 kids and almost 17,000 Moms. The study’s analysis focused on the association between a mother’s lifestyle habits and the incidence of childhood obesity between the ages of 9 and […]
